Ive had problems installing this, in the following order. Openam supports multiple options for enforcing policy and protecting resources, including policy agents that reside on web or application servers, a proxy server, or the openig identity gateway. Whatever the decision agent receives from the access management whether to allow or deny access to the protected resource, the agent enforces it. Installation and configuration of openam with tomcat. Openam openam apache policy agent and goto normalized. Integrating openssoopenam with liferay portal on tomcat. Openam java ee policy agents provide medium touch integration for web applications running in supported web application containers. This will create the configuration for your openam server under opensso or c. Openam provides policy agents, which run along with the application or web server.
Create tomcat6 agent profile login openam add a new j2ee agent named tomcat6 select new agent and enable sso only mode. Use a language purposebuilt for policy in a world where json is pervasive. I am not sure why this question is marked negative but as i am getting more into the installation on linux based system, i am getting a feel that all the released version are not free to use as the wget is fetching empty jar files for all the enterprise version even if username and password is provided. Forgerock customers are digital transformation leaders who use the power of digital identity to grow their business, manage security risks, improve workforce productivity, and reduce costs. Netmono policy agents windowslinux openam web policy agent apache 2. Cisco unified communications operating system administration guide, release 10. We offer endtoend capability designed to scale into the billions. Go into access control realm profiles j2ee profiles. Openam docker all os download openam policy agents.
Openam provides support for keeping user information in a separate data store like active directory. Dont use the version of tomcat that comes with xampp. The policy agent configures itself according to a centralised configuration stored in an agent profile on openam. If you are looking to deploy the forgerock identity platform in docker, please consult the devops developers guide. Contribute to forgerocknodeopenamagent development by creating an account on github.
Each virtual host has its own web policy agent configuration. Digital identity for consumers and workforce forgerock. Agents protect content on designated deployment containers, such as web servers and application servers, from unauthorized intrusions. A realm is an openam concept and a feature which is used to group and organise the information and configuration parameters.
A web policy agent installed in a web server intercepts requests from users trying to access a protected web resource, and denies access until the user has authorization from openam to access the resource. Openig runs as a selfcontained gateway and protects web applications where installing a policy agent is not possible. That web policy agent is only one of many policy agents that work with openam. Java ee policy agents require some configuration and code changes to deployed web applications. Cache using redis for the openam policy agent for nodejs homepage npm javascript download. After almost 15 years in the ops and integration world, working with siteminder, a bunch of peers have been asking me how siteminder compares to openam and how they differ. The architecture used in this article is again based on the architecture i used in my previous articles 1. No longer able to access tomcat manager after openam j2ee. Default policy agent user policy01 configurator summary details click create configuration. Express policy in a highlevel, declarative language that promotes safe, performant, finegrained controls. Forgerock access management provides authentication, authorization, entitlement, and federation functionality. Select from one of our main platform components below to access downloads. This chapter covers what java ee policy agents do and how they work. Also verify the checksum of the file you download against the checksum posted on the download page.
I prepared one more article about openam, now it is about openam web policy agent. This article is an example how to use openam to protect resources on a web server. Policy agents protect the resources on the server based on the policy defined in the server. You most likely used one of the settings override request url protocol override request url host override request url port as you might use ssloffloading. Setting up openam for web authentication linux for you. If you were accessing unprotected content, you should edit the url pattern that openam should protect in.
Forgerock access management is a single, unified solution that provides the most comprehensive and flexible set of services to meet todays identity and access management iam requirements. Web policy agents 4 support installing agents into multiple virtual hosts on apache web servers. This configuration provides a mechanism to have encrypted assertions for openig without the dependencies of a policy agent or openam post authentication plugin. Configuring policy agent profiles in the administration guide describes policy agents for different web servers, for a variety of java ee web application containers, for protecting soapbased web services, and for oauth 2. Furthermore, when applicable, this section provides the property label used with the property names. Enterprise downloads has the latest stable version of openam, including a. We built the forgerock identity platform from the ground up, designed from the outset as a unified model to integrate with any of your digital services. You need to define policy to create the proper authorization rules to grant access. Openam apache policy agent and goto normalized from s to the url is changed by the agent code, because you told the agent to do this. The honours of enforcing a policy decision sent by openam is on forgerock openig 4. Install openam agent download iis web policy agent, e. In prior releases, only property names were used for the properties. The policy agent protects webbased applications and implements single signon sso capabilities for the applications deployed in the container. Unzip the zip file into the directory were you wish to install the web policy agent.
Openam apache policy agent, to intercept requests from users and to enforce openam formulated access policy decisions. When you install a openam web agent it is enabled by default and blocks access. Install openam agent download tomcat policy agent from forgerock, e. It guides the audience on how to configure and use it. Login to the openam console and create a new agent profile for the new web policy agent. The policy agent enforces policy both by redirecting users to openam for authentication and by contacting openam to get authorization decisions for resources such as the web page to protect.
Protecting a sample application on tomcat in this section, i am going to show you how one can install the policy agents on the tomcat server and configure the sample application agentsample. Follow the steps in the next sections of this chapter to see how openam can protect a web site without changing the web site itself. Openam web policy agents 4 openam web policy agent. How to install and configure openam web policy agent. Download the latest version of openam from backstage, you can sign up to get an evaluation version free of charge. Forgerock access management is built to orchestrate and manage access at scale for any use case, including workforce, consumer, iot, and apis using a variety of next. The policy agent user password would be used if we were integrating a policy agent with openam. Download the latest apache web policy agent from forgerocks download pages. Openam has a top level realm which contains all other, userdefined, realms. Dependencies 3 dependent packages 0 dependent repositories 0 total releases 2 latest release. The openam documentation recommends to use a separate web server to deploy the openam application and use openig in order to bridge openam to incompatible application servers like in the case of payara server, so instead of using an openam policy agent, an openig route configuration is needed to delegate authentication and authorization to. Openam zip all os openam war all os openam docker all os download openam policy agents.
Access control in sun opensso enterprise is enforced using agents. We will try here to demonstrate the realm functionality on a simple but practical scenario where realms will be used to separate. In the am console under realms realm name applications agents web agent name openam services policy client service, set user id parameter and user id parameter type, and. Since openam is a java web application, the java development kit kit is preinstalled. Part 4 install, configure iis agent, and create authorization policy recently i joined forgerock as a senior consultant. Installing and deploying an apache web policy agent for openam. Select new agent and enable sso only mode if web server is behind a load balancer then go to advanced tab select all load balancer options. Agent configuration is needed to allow access to unprotected urls. You would still be unauthorized after a successful authentication.
260 251 156 320 1539 852 184 415 348 245 393 666 41 843 1433 849 1258 926 12 1594 1476 550 1438 495 46 1228 411 266 1098 7 336 25 737 152 1467 407 1315 1439 395 485 189 476 332 1106 16 1235